Susie the Guide Dog



This post is about Susie, the guide dog puppy that was. We received Susie March of 2007, and having been the first guide dog puppy that we raised, we were a little scared. She came home to us with a furor of energy and a keen sense of adventure. Susie did end up graduating from Guide Dogs for the Blind in October of 2008 with her blind partner Hank, a man who got news of his loss of sight when Susie was born in October of 2006. They were destined to be together, however only a year after receiving Susie, Hank felt that she was too dog distracted. Susie ended up being retired by GDB and now Hank has another seeing eye dog named Lincoln. Hank had final say in where Susie would live and ultimately Susie ended up with Hank's sister-in-law in Arkansas.
